(Korean: Kwa-sok-seu-kaen-deul ), released in 2008, is a landmark South Korean comedy-drama that became the highest-grossing film of its year [6]. Directed by Kang Hyeong-cheol in his directorial debut, the film stars Cha Tae-hyun, Park Bo-young, and Wang Seok-hyeon [6]. Plot Overview

The story follows Nam Hyeon-soo, a popular 30-something radio DJ and former teen idol who enjoys a sleek, bachelor lifestyle [1, 3]. His world is turned upside down when a young single mother, Hwang Jeong-nam, appears at his door claiming to be his daughter—the result of a brief encounter during his own teenage years [1, 3]. To make matters more complicated, she brings along her young son, Gi-dong, making the bachelor entertainer an instant grandfather [4, 7].
